Roy from England joins Sunrisers Hyderabad IPL side to replace Marsh

(Reuters) – English opener Jason Roy has joined Indian Premier League (IPL) side Sunrisers Hyderabad in place of Mitchell Marsh of Australia, the league said yesterday.

Marsh, who made his first IPL appearance in 2010 having played a total of 21 games, is making himself unavailable for the 2021 season starting next month due to personal reasons.

He was ruled out of the 2020 campaign after the Sunrisers’ first game due to an ankle injury and was replaced by Jason Holder of the West Indies.

The IPL said Royris acquired it from Sunrisers for its base price of 20 million Indian rupees ($ 273,332).

Roy had opted out of the Delhi Capitals 2020 campaign for personal reasons. He has played a total of eight IPL games scoring 179 runs including half a century.

He scored 144 runs in the Twenty20 five-match series against India earlier this month before making 115 runs in three one-day internationals against the same opponents.

($ 1 = 73.1710 Indian rupees)
